A number of the very same techniques made use of in specific treatment are used in group treatment, such as psychoeducation, motivational talking to, and skill advancement. Group therapy is related to positive results for addiction recovery because of the social assistance it offers. Members take advantage of sharing their experiences, hearing other individuals's tales, creating bonds, and sustaining each other.

Compound use condition treatment programs normally come under 1 of 2 classifications: inpatient or outpatient. While equally concentrated on rehabilitation, each kind has distinct attributes and benefits to offer. Inpatient therapy programs, also understood as household therapy programs, are intensive and are designed to deal with serious compound use conditions and dependencies.

A common inpatient program runs anywhere from thirty days to 6 months. The very first action in inpatient treatment, for many, is clinically aided detox. During detoxification, doctors and dependency experts keep an eye on people' vital indications while the substances leave the system. Medicine desires are common throughout detoxification and can be helpful resources tough to overcome, usually resulting in relapse.


Clinicians can supply essential medication and clinical experience to lessen food cravings and withdrawals. In some instances, withdrawals can be deadly.

Patients with moderate to modest compound withdrawal symptoms may locate outpatient detoxification a suitable alternative to residential detoxification. Outpatient detoxification is safe, reliable, and can be much more flexible for those that are deemed prepared by a therapy specialist. Unlike property detox, patients need to visit a healthcare facility or other therapy facility for physical and mental examinations throughout outpatient detox.
